Infrastructure is a quality-of-life problem. When it is right, engineers ship several times a day and nobody thinks about it. When it is wrong, every release is an event, the bill grows for reasons nobody can explain, and the person who set it up is the only one who understands it.

We build infrastructure the second engineer can operate. Everything in code, everything reproducible, everything documented — and a monthly bill you can trace line by line to something you actually use.

What we build

Everything below is Cloud and DevOps work we have shipped to production.

Cloud architecture & migration

AWS Mumbai and Hyderabad region design, VPC and network layout, managed databases, autoscaling, and lift-and-shift or re-platform migrations from wherever you are today.

Containerisation

Docker images built for size and cold-start, Compose for development parity, and orchestration on ECS or Kubernetes when the scale actually justifies it.

CI/CD pipelines

Test, lint, typecheck, build, migrate and deploy — automated on GitHub Actions, with staged environments, database migration gates and single-command rollback.

Observability

Structured JSON logging, metrics, distributed traces, uptime checks, error tracking in Sentry, and alerts that page a human only when a human is needed.

Security hardening

Secrets management, least-privilege IAM, TLS everywhere, dependency and image scanning, WAF and rate limiting, encrypted and tested backups.

Cost optimisation

A line-by-line audit of your cloud spend: right-sizing, reserved capacity, storage lifecycle rules, egress reduction and cutting the services nobody has used in months.

How the engagement runs

Same five stages every time, so you always know what week you are in and what comes next.

01

Discover

We start by understanding the business, not the feature list. Who is the user, what decision are they trying to make, what does success look like in numbers, and what is genuinely fixed versus assumed. Usually this reshapes the brief.

02

Design

Flows before pixels, then high-fidelity screens covering every state that matters — including the empty, offline and error states most projects discover late. Architecture is decided here too, and written down with its trade-offs.

03

Build

Two-week iterations, something in a real environment every single week, and a demo you can use rather than a status report you have to read. Typed contracts and CI keep the frontend and backend honest with each other.

04

Ship

Launch is a process, not a date: staged rollout, monitoring and alerting live before the first user, store submissions prepared against current policy, and a rollback path that has been tested rather than assumed.

05

Scale

After launch the questions change: what do users actually do, where does it cost too much, what breaks first at ten times the load. We instrument, review monthly, and plan the next quarter from evidence.
